Getting the Chicken Crossing Started
Chicken Road Slot is a crash‑style casino game that feels more like a quick sprint than a marathon. You begin by setting your stake—tiny or sizable—and choosing a difficulty level that matches your appetite for speed. The grid appears, and the chicken takes its first hesitant hop across the road, oblivious to hidden manhole covers and fiery ovens waiting beneath.
The interface is deliberately simple; a large multiplier counter scrolls up as the chicken steps forward, and a single button invites you to cash out at any moment. Your goal? Beat the chicken into the golden egg before it falls into a trap, grabbing whatever multiplier it has built up by the time you decide to stop.
This setup rewards quick decision making: the shorter the session, the more you can ride the adrenaline wave and lock in small gains before the chicken takes a tumble.

Choosing the Right Difficulty for Sprint Play
The game offers four difficulty levels—Easy, Medium, Hard, and Hardcore—each altering step count and risk per hop.
- Easy (24 steps): Best for nonstop quick wins; lower volatility and smaller maximum multipliers keep sessions brisk.
- Medium (22 steps): Adds a bit more tension while still allowing rapid rounds.
- Hard (20 steps): Suitable if you want slightly higher potential but are comfortable with modest risk.
- Hardcore (15 steps): Not for short sessions; higher chance of losing early and slower pacing.
Select Easy or Medium if you want to keep each round under two minutes and maintain a high session count.
